Green Arrow vs. Komodo (GREEN ARROW #19)

Creative panel layout, vivid artwork and an over the top fight made Green Arrow vs. Komodo and his daughter and obvious choice this week. The fight began with Ollie falling to his death, but as expected, he didn't plummet to his doom. Instead, he grabbed onto the ledge directly in front of Komodo and promptly stabbed the dude's foot with an arrow. What happens next is this awesome and chaotic freefall.

Komodo has proven one step ahead of Ollie and that once again holds true. He tags the Emerald Archer with a ricochet shot and follows up with a vicious volley of arrows and, just to be safe, a fist to the face (see below to feel our hero's pain). Ollie isn't exactly Wolverine, so taking this amount of damage isn't something he can exactly walk off. Despite the extensive damage, he manages to pull off an epic action roll and takes down the villain with one well placed shot.

Before Ollie can discover who's behind the mask, the villain's daughter, Emiko Lacroix, enters the fray. Ollie makes the mistake of underestimating the wee lad because she's apparently sporting some degree of superhuman speed. The little girl is firing arrows way faster than him and, after taking yet another arrow, Ollie realizes it's time to bolt. So, like a true hero, he dives out through the construction waste tube. Toxin vs "Slayback's brother" (VENOM #33)

As you can tell by the title, I have no idea what this experiment's name is. In fact, I don't think one has even been provided in the pages. But you know what? That doesn't matter when Declan Shalvey is illustrating him and Cullen Bunn is putting him through insane fights. In this issue, the crazy monster faces off against an equally horrendous and frightening character: Toxin. Oh yes, the time has come to see Eddie Brock kick some ass.

While this dude's physicals stats aren't clearly defined, we all know Toxin is quite a powerhouse. Under Rick Remender he was a huge brute and prior to that he could take on Venom and Carnage at once. Clearly, that still holds true because, despite taking a few slashes here and there, he dictates the majority of this fight and it's not long before there's a dismemberment.

From here, Toxin tries to "Bane" his foe... except instead of breaking him over his knee, he's trying to accomplish the feat with his raw strength. But there's a wildcard here. You notice those huge tanks and all that on the villain? He's the result of an experiment and these seemingly sentient synthetics jump into action and give Toxin two painful pokes to the chest.

Bane vs. Talons (DETECTIVE COMICS #900)

Excuse me while I let my inner fanboy take over... BANE IS BACK OH MY GOD YES! Sorry, couldn't help it. Bane's without question my favorite DC villain, so I'm thrilled to see him return after a not-so epic initial debut in The New 52. In the hands of James Tynion IV, I'm happy to see Bane once again seems to be a nice balance of brains and brawn.
